Getting back to this one, esp after all the great improvements this last summer.
This could involve setting up a new repository in which we have a containerized/dockerized node version of image-sequencer which can accept commands via REST API calls.
The string syntax makes this MUCH easier, by allowing us to pass an image or url plus an instruction set. An image would be output.
Another thing we could offer is a callback url maybe!
So if we imagined what a POST request payload would look like, it might include:
// Request:
{
img_src: "...",
callback: "https://...",
commandString: "blur,brightness..."
}
// Response:
{
progress_url: "https://...",
status: "success"
}

Some Image processing steps can be resource intensive and it might be difficult for users with low powered devices to run them locally one the device, for this purpose we can setup an Express server with an api that can take an image in request and return the step applied image in response. For this purpose we can use https://www.npmjs.com/package/express for building the server and imgur for hosting the images. The image at all steps will be uploaded to imgur. https://imgur.com We can start very basic with support for a single step and later add functionalities add multiple steps and replace steps The demo will have a choice if user want to run on local machine or remote server for each step, we can also limit this in the basis of user's computer specification to prevent overloading the server
